Question: What are the key factors to consider when selecting the best external hard drive for Mac?
Answer: Key factors to consider when selecting the best external hard drive for Mac include storage capacity, connectivity options (such as USB-C, Thunderbolt, or FireWire), compatibility with Mac file systems (such as HFS+ or APFS), data transfer speed, durability, and overall reliability.

Question: Are there any specific considerations for Mac users when choosing an external hard drive?
Answer: Yes, there are specific considerations for Mac users when choosing an external hard drive. Mac users need to ensure that the external hard drive is compatible with macOS file systems, such as HFS+ or APFS, and has the necessary connectivity options, such as USB-C or Thunderbolt, to ensure seamless integration with Mac computers.
